| BenRiach 12 Year Old Heredotus Fumosus | DYC 8 Year Old | |
|---|---|---|
| Distillery | Benriach | DYC |
| Region | Speyside | — |
| Country | Scotland | Spain |
| Type | Single Malt | Blended |
| ABV | 46% | 40% |
| Age | 12 yr | 8 yr |
| Price | £32.12 | £23.95 |
| Rating | 4.86/5 | 4.25/5 |

Who should buy BenRiach?
BenRiach 12 Year Old Heredotus Fumosus suits whisky enthusiasts looking for a well-rounded, complex dram. It rewards those with some experience and an appreciation for Speyside character.
Who should buy DYC?
DYC 8 Year Old is an ideal first whisky — sweet, approachable, and widely available. It's a great gift and a safe choice for anyone new to whisky or who prefers lighter, friendlier drams.
